Use AI to prepare a clear patient case presentation before discussing complex treatment options with parents.
When you need to present a complex treatment plan to parents — especially for cases involving special needs kids, sedation dentistry, or multi-visit phased care — it helps to organize your thoughts in advance. Walking through the case out loud with AI helps you anticipate parent questions, structure your explanation clearly, and prepare analogies that make sense to non-dental families. This workflow turns a messy treatment plan into a confident, parent-ready conversation. 1. Open ChatGPT or Claude and briefly describe the treatment you're recommending (no real patient names or identifying details — use a fictional placeholder like "8-year-old with severe caries on molars 19 and 30"). 2. Ask AI to help you organize the case into a simple parent-friendly narrative: why treatment is needed, what it involves, timeline, and expected outcomes. 3. Request three common parent questions this case might trigger, and draft answers for each in simple language. 4. Ask AI to suggest one everyday analogy that makes the treatment easier to understand for a non-clinical parent. 5. Have AI create a short summary you can use as talking points during the consultation. 6. Review and adjust the language to match your voice and clinical standards, then use it as your guide during the real conversation. Remember: AI helps you prepare, but your clinical judgment and relationship with the family are what matter most.
Try this prompt today
“I need to present a treatment plan to the parents of an 8-year-old who needs pulp therapy and stainless steel crowns on two primary molars due to severe decay. Help me organize this into a clear, parent-friendly explanation that covers: why this treatment is necessary, what the procedure involves, how long it takes, and what to expect afterward. Then give me three questions parents typically ask in this situation and simple answers for each. Finally, suggest one everyday analogy that helps parents understand why we're treating baby teeth this way.”
